ttn pushed a commit to branch master
in repository elpa.
commit b92184003bad90b8bb74fbcb77460854c457032b
Author: Thien-Thi Nguyen <address@hidden>
Date: Fri Feb 7 15:22:20 2014 +0100
[gnugo int] Drop leading "*" in docstrings.
* packages/gnugo/gnugo.el (gnugo-program, gnugo-board-mode-hook)
(gnugo-post-move-hook, gnugo-animation-string, gnugo-mode-line)
(gnugo-X-face, gnugo-O-face, gnugo-grid-face): ...here.
